Output ecdf2c8bb13613555ab0817a1c218a88c09d786ae68d3875cf7e4be93f702c8d:0

value
699290
script pubkey
OP_0 OP_PUSHBYTES_20 5368b781e3e91f0831c2a7a21417cb87fb3e12dc
address
bc1q2d5t0q0ray0ssvwz573pg97tslanuyku024h84
transaction
ecdf2c8bb13613555ab0817a1c218a88c09d786ae68d3875cf7e4be93f702c8d
confirmations
166777
spent
true